The busy-bee buzz of additional workers will soon descend upon the Lisbon post of the Ohio State Highway Patrol. But at the Canfield post, the sounds of chirping crickets may be the only audible noise outside of regular business hours.
Starting Aug. 25, highway patrol dispatching operations will be eliminated in Canfield and doubled in Lisbon, part of a statewide dispatching consolidation, said Lt. Michael Orosz, the Lisbon Post Commander.
